None - we never put boots on the mares, foals, yearlings or breakers for travelling. And the racehorses returning from out of training only have the pads that wrap around. I don't even boot my horse, he had a suspensory injury 18 months ago and the vets (Rossdales) said to not boot were possible due to overheating. Simples. I can't stand those big long boots, they can be a nightmare if they slip. The most I use is over reach boots.
